最短路
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 50863 Accepted Submission(s): 22365
Problem Description
在每年的校赛里,所有进入决赛的同学都会获...
分类:
其他好文 时间:
2016-05-13 02:02:34
阅读次数:
158
Floyd算法,多源最短路,O(n^3)
所以时间很受限制……
主要注意细节,记住简单的三层for循环就好
1.初始化输入:
多样例,所以数组清空
注意重边情况,注意自己到自己是0
2.三层for
循环遍历每个点k, 循环计算map[i][j],看i->j最小还是i->k->j最小。
hdu1874
#include
#include
#d...
分类:
Web程序 时间:
2016-05-13 00:56:49
阅读次数:
288
Sorting It All Out
Time Limit: 1000MS
Memory Limit: 10000K
Total Submissions: 31994
Accepted: 11117
Description
An ascending sorted sequence of dist...
分类:
编程语言 时间:
2016-05-13 00:40:24
阅读次数:
252
给出一个有向无环图,问最少多少条边就可以覆盖所有的点,很明显的最少路径覆盖问题,但是点可以重复用,这与hungary算法不太一样,我们可以这样处理,假设a要经过b点到c,但是b点已经被访问过,为了保证a顺利到c,就让a直接飞过b到c,也就是说添加一条a到c的边,这其实就是求传递闭包,我们可以通过floyd算法求出。然后ans=n-hungary()。
一开始用了邻接表的最大二分匹配,在求闭包...
分类:
其他好文 时间:
2016-05-12 16:13:36
阅读次数:
232
Stockbroker Grapevine
Time Limit: 1000MS
Memory Limit: 10000K
Total Submissions: 33164
Accepted: 18259
Description
Stockbrokers are known to overreact to rumours. You...
分类:
其他好文 时间:
2016-05-12 15:55:58
阅读次数:
114
Floyd算法Floyd算法又称为插点法,是一种用于寻找给定的加权图中多源点之间最短路径的算法。该算法名称以创始人之一、1978年图灵奖获得者、斯坦福大学计算机科学系教授罗伯特·弗洛伊德命名。思路路径矩阵通过一个图的权值矩阵求出它的每两点间的最短路径矩阵。
从图的带权邻接矩阵A=[a(i,j)] n×n开始,递归地进行n次更新,即由矩阵D(0)=A,按一个公式,构造出矩阵D(1);又用同样地公式...
分类:
编程语言 时间:
2016-05-11 07:23:28
阅读次数:
275
需要处理好字典序最小的路径 HDU1385(ZOJ1456)-Minimum Transport ...
分类:
其他好文 时间:
2016-05-09 00:17:10
阅读次数:
307
首先,对图进行一次Floyd(g[][]是图) 1.dfs:(u是当前在的节点,d是已经走的路程) 起初我认为n<=15是dfs完全可以解决的,但是忽略了一个问题:每对城市之间都可以互相到达,边特别多,结果TLE ^_^; 正解是压缩状态的dp: dp[u][s]表示状态:走到u这个点并且前面已经走 ...
分类:
其他好文 时间:
2016-05-08 19:40:43
阅读次数:
129
传送门题意:K个产奶机,C头奶牛,每个产奶机最多可供M头奶牛使用;并告诉了产奶机、奶牛之间的两两距离Dij(0<=i,j < K+c)。问题:如何安排使得在任何一头奶牛都有自己产奶机的条件下,奶牛到产奶机的最远距离最短?最短是多少?Dinic算法先floyd求得两两之间最小距离,然后二分寻找答案邻接链表的方法#include
#include
#includ...
分类:
其他好文 时间:
2016-05-07 10:24:23
阅读次数:
137
原题:http://poj.org/problem?id=2112
#include
#include
#include
#include
#include
#include
#define inf 0x3f3f3f3f
using namespace std;
const int maxn = 250;
int dis[maxn][maxn];
int k, c, m;
int num...
分类:
其他好文 时间:
2016-05-07 10:18:18
阅读次数:
116